Recognize and prevent phishing
Phishing scams are a serious threat online, aiming to fool you into revealing sensitive data. These attempts often come in the form of messages that appear to be from legitimate sources, but are actually fraudulent. To protect yourself, it's important to learn how to spot phishing attempts and stop them.
- Always examine the sender's email details. Look for typos, unusual characters, or misspellings that could indicate a fake sender.
- Be wary on links in suspicious emails. Instead, access the website directly by typing the URL into your browser.
- Under no circumstances personal information, such as passwords or credit card numbers, via email unless you are certain of the sender's identity.
- Secure passwords for all your online accounts and use multi-factor authentication whenever possible.
- Flag any suspected phishing attempts to the appropriate authorities. This can help protect others from becoming targets.
Securing Your Privacy Online
In today's virtual world, protecting your privacy online is more important than ever. With constant data gathering by platforms, it's imperative to implement steps to secure your personal details. A solid password is a primary step, and you should consistently update it. Be mindful of the data you reveal online, as just apparently harmless details can be used.
Leverage strong protection tools and programs to protect your connections and personal data. Be cautious of deceitful attempts that aim to manipulate you into disclosing your data. Regularly check your privacy settings on social media platforms and customize them to reflect your desires.
Remember, safeguarding your online privacy is an continuous process that demands your vigilance. By observing these tips, you can reduce the risks and utilize a protected online space.
Protective Browsing Habits
Staying secure online is crucial in today's digital world. Here are some tips to boost your online safety: Always check the URL of a website before entering any private click here information. Be wary of unfamiliar links and emails, as they could lead to harmful websites. Install a reputable antivirus software on your device to protect against viruses. Regularly update your browser and operating system to repair any security vulnerabilities. Be mindful of the information you reveal online, as it can be accessed by a wide audience.
